There’s so much good stuff here. Warren’s parents are deranged versions of Ma and Pa Kent (“This tastes like horse piss. And yes, Rhoda, I know what horse piss tastes like. I was in the war.”). There’s a hilarious sequence where Warren tries working for his father as a party entertainer. It ends badly. And there’s a laugh-out-loud bit where Captain Supreme applies for a loan in the middle of a bank robbery. There are so many funny scenes here, but they don’t get in the way of a solid emotional arc. Warren’s a guy that you’ll care about, even as his situation gets worse and worse.
